PM Modi’s Chhattisgarh Visit: A Day of Development and Dialogue
Prime Minister Narendra Modi recently visited Chhattisgarh, marking the occasion with a series of significant events aimed at fostering development and engaging with the local community. The visit, which included a roadshow in Raipur, underscored the government’s commitment to the state’s progress. This visit was particularly notable as it coincided with the celebration of Chhattisgarh’s 25th Foundation Day.
Roadshow and Economic Boost
During his visit, PM Modi participated in a vibrant roadshow, a public display of support and a direct interaction with the people of Chhattisgarh. A key highlight of the visit was the announcement of a substantial development package, a souvenir of ₹14,260 crore. This financial commitment is designed to boost various sectors within the state, reinforcing the government’s dedication to Chhattisgarh’s economic growth. The initiative aims to transform the state, particularly the Maoist-affected areas, into hubs of rapid development.
